Advanced Switching Topics[edit | edit source]

IP source guard without DHCP When DHCP snooping is enabled, a switch maintains a database of the DHCP addresses assigned to the hosts connected to each access port. IP source guard references this database when a packet is received on any of these interfaces and compares the source address to the assigned address listed in the database. If the source address differs from the "allowed" address, the packet is assumed to spoofed and is discarded. Assuming DHCP isn't available or in use on a subnet, static IP bindings can be manually configured per access port to achieve the same effect.
